DomainTools.com
has released the preliminary
inventory list for their online domain
auction that culminates on Thursday, January 3.
This is the same company that staged a |
successful live auction at
the Domain
Roundtable conference in Seattle in
August. You can start bidding in the auction Monday
(Dec. 31) but the lots won't start closing until 11am
U.S. Pacific Time (2pm Eastern) on Thursday. Each
lot will close one after another - the same format used
for live auctions at the various conferences.
DomainTools said the auction should take about 90
minutes for all lots to close. To bid you will need to
have or create a DomainTools.com
account and put a credit card on file. More information
is available here. |
